Judge Ralph K. Winter Lecture: Robert Barro

Professor Robert Barro of Harvard University gave the Judge Ralph K. Winter Lecture titled “Fiscal Influences on OECD Countries, 2020-2023” on Feb. 10, 2025.

Barro is the Paul M. Warburg Professor of Economics at Harvard University, a visiting scholar at the American Enterprise Institute, and a research associate of the National Bureau of Economic Research. He has a Ph.D. in economics from Harvard University and a B.S. in physics from Caltech. Professor Barro’s recent research involves rare macroeconomic disasters, corporate tax reform, religion & economy, empirical determinants of economic growth, and economic effects of public debt and budget deficits.
